Collocations
'扇耳光' (shān ěrguāng) is the common collocation for 'to slap someone in the face', while '扇风' (shān fēng) means 'to fan the air'.
Common mistakes
The character '扇' is also pronounced 'shàn' as a noun meaning 'fan', but when used as a verb meaning 'to fan' or 'to slap', it is pronounced 'shān'.
